NET_STRING

Представляет типы сетевых адресов. Используйте одну или несколько (в виде побитового сочетания) следующих констант, чтобы создать маску сетевого адреса, используемую с NetAddr_SetAllowType макроса.

Константа Описание
NET_STRING_IPV4_ADDRESS
Строка идентифицирует узел или маршрутизатор IPv4 с помощью литерального адреса (порт или префикс не разрешен).
NET_STRING_IPV4_SERVICE
Строка идентифицирует службу IPv4 с помощью литерального адреса (требуется порт; префикс не разрешен).
NET_STRING_IPV4_NETWORK
Строка идентифицирует сеть IPv4 (требуется префикс; порт не разрешен).
NET_STRING_IPV6_ADDRESS
Строка идентифицирует узел или маршрутизатор IPv6 с помощью литерального адреса (порт или префикс не допускается; область идентификатор разрешен.)
NET_STRING_IPV6_ADDRESS_NO_SCOPE
Строка идентифицирует узел или маршрутизатор IPv6 с помощью литерального адреса, где контекст интерфейса уже известен (порт или префикс не разрешен; область идентификатор не разрешен).
NET_STRING_IPV6_SERVICE
Строка идентифицирует службу IPv6 с помощью литерального адреса (требуется порт; префикс не разрешен; область идентификатор разрешен).
NET_STRING_IPV6_SERVICE_NO_SCOPE
Строка идентифицирует службу IPv6 с помощью литерального адреса, где контекст интерфейса уже известен (требуется порт; префикс не разрешен; область идентификатор не разрешен).
NET_STRING_IPV6_NETWORK
Строка определяет сеть IPv6 (требуется префикс; порт или область идентификатор не разрешен).
NET_STRING_NAMED_ADDRESS
Строка идентифицирует узел Интернета с помощью DNS(порт, префикс или область-id не разрешено).
NET_STRING_NAMED_SERVICE
Строка идентифицирует интернет-службу с помощью DNS (требуется порт; префикс или область идентификатор не разрешен).
NET_STRING_IP_ADDRESS
NET_STRING_IPV4_ADDRESS | NET_STRING_IPV6_ADDRESS.
NET_STRING_IP_ADDRESS_NO_SCOPE
NET_STRING_IPV4_ADDRESS | NET_STRING_IPV6_ADDRESS_NO_SCOPE.
NET_STRING_IP_SERVICE
NET_STRING_IPV4_SERVICE | NET_STRING_IPV6_SERVICE.
NET_STRING_IP_SERVICE_NO_SCOPE
NET_STRING_NAMED_ADDRESS | NET_STRING_IP_ADDRESS_NO_SCOPE.
NET_STRING_IP_NETWORK
NET_STRING_IPV4_NETWORK | NET_STRING_IPV6_NETWORK.
NET_STRING_ANY_ADDRESS
NET_STRING_NAMED_ADDRESS | NET_STRING_IP_ADDRESS.
NET_STRING_ANY_ADDRESS_NO_SCOPE
NET_STRING_NAMED_ADDRESS | NET_STRING_IP_ADDRESS_NO_SCOPE.
NET_STRING_ANY_SERVICE
NET_STRING_NAMED_SERVICE | NET_STRING_IP_SERVICE.
NET_STRING_ANY_SERVICE_NO_SCOPE
NET_STRING_NAMED_ADDRESS | NET_STRING_IP_ADDRESS_NO_SCOPE.

Комментарии

Эти значения определены в Iphlpapi.h.

Требования

Требование Значение
Минимальная версия клиента
Windows Vista [только классические приложения]
Минимальная версия сервера
Windows Server 2008 [только классические приложения]
Заголовок
Iphlpapi.h